Transaction 299a03b7de8050bf8b8a0f40e8764d36181280c161bf5208eed6fc234bba21a9
1 Input
1 Output
-
299a03b7de8050bf8b8a0f40e8764d36181280c161bf5208eed6fc234bba21a9:0
- value
- 928780
- script pubkey
- OP_0 OP_PUSHBYTES_20 10ae5acf76415dcc57bb42df96f6753d82d90c81
- address
- bc1qzzh94nmkg9wuc4amgt0edan48kpdjrypw9wfyd